//! Windowing and the application event loop. //! //! Stage 2 scope: open a window via `winit`, hand its surface to the //! [`render`](crate::render) module, and run a clear-color render loop. //! Applications implement [`WindowApp`] and are driven by [`run`]; raw window //! events (keyboard, mouse, resize, …) are forwarded to //! [`WindowApp::event`] untranslated — input abstraction arrives in Stage 5. //! //! Stage 6 renamed this trait from `App` to `WindowApp` so the engine's core //! [`App`](crate::app::App) container — the owner of scene, assets, and //! scheduled systems — can live in the prelude unambiguously. The two are //! distinct roles: this trait is the **window-event handler** the editor and //! examples implement; the core `App` is the engine state they typically wrap //! around. mod app; mod runner; pub use app::{AppCtx, RenderCtx, WindowApp}; pub use runner::run; pub mod event { //! Raw window/input event types, re-exported from `winit`. //! //! Stage 2 deliberately exposes events untranslated; the Stage 5 input //! system will layer action mapping on top of these. pub use winit::dpi::{PhysicalPosition, PhysicalSize}; pub use winit::event::{ DeviceEvent, DeviceId, ElementState, KeyEvent, Modifiers, MouseButton, MouseScrollDelta, WindowEvent, }; pub use winit::keyboard::{Key, KeyCode, ModifiersState, NamedKey, PhysicalKey}; } use crate::math::Color; /// Initial window settings, consumed by [`run`]. #[derive(Debug, Clone)] pub struct WindowConfig { /// Window title. pub title: String, /// Initial inner width in logical pixels. pub width: u32, /// Initial inner height in logical pixels. pub height: u32, /// Whether the user can resize the window. pub resizable: bool, /// Color the surface is cleared to each frame (changeable at runtime via /// [`AppCtx::set_clear_color`]). pub clear_color: Color, } impl Default for WindowConfig { fn default() -> Self { Self { title: "Oxide".to_string(), width: 1280, height: 720, resizable: true, clear_color: Color::BLACK, } } }
